Coin Drive - Scholarship Fundraiser Update
Through the kindness and generosity of our Collins students and families we have raised an estimated $7,500 for the Donald R. Collins Senior Scholarship through our Coin Collection this past week. For the past six years we have awarded four former Collins Cobras a $1000 scholarship. This year we will award SEVEN $1000 scholarships. The words "Thank You" are not nearly enough to express our appreciation.
A very special thank you to the Katta Foundation for their $1000.00 donation to the Donald R. Collins Senior Scholarship.

Library Updates
The last day for students to check out books is May 10. All library books will be due on May 14.
If you need to pay for a lost book, understand:
1. Unpaid for books that have been lost will stay on your student’s account as long as they are in Conroe ISD, even if they change buildings.
2.Once a book is paid for, it is yours to keep if found at a later date. It is removed from our system once a student has paid for it.
3. You can pay with a check made out to the school the book was checked out at, or, if a book is overdue by 3 months or more, it can be paid online through the school cash online. If you choose to pay online, a handling fee will be added to the amount.
4. We would much rather have the book back than have you pay for it, so please do a good search of family places including under the bed, on the book shelf, in the closet, etc.
Students will be able to pay online for Collins books only. Books from other campuses will need to be paid by check made payable to the campus the books came from. Questions about books from other campuses can be directed to that campus's librarian. I am unable to update or clarify that information.
Students can check their library account anytime by logging into Destiny Discover from the SSO. Just click on the 3 lines on the left side of the page to log in and look it up.
Sora online ebooks will be available all summer long! If your student is moving campuses, they will need to reassign to their new school once they are enrolled. Do this by right clicking on the sora app in the sso. Then manage credentials. Enter their log in info and choose their new campus.
